  1. 16. Fängelse, skola, uppfostringsanstalt eller skyddshem? : Åkerbrukskolonien Hall för pojkar år 1876-1940

    Författare :Ulrika Norburg; Bengt Sandin; Roddy Nilsson; Linköpings universitet; []
    Nyckelord :HUMANIORA; HUMANITIES; SAMHÄLLSVETENSKAP; SOCIAL SCIENCES; Children; class; criminality; criminal care; delinquency; discipline; masculinity normality; philanthropy; school; training school; visibility and youths; Barn; brottslighet; disciplinering; filantropi; fångvård; klass; maskulinitet; normalitet; skola; synliggörande; ungdomar; uppfostringsanstalt och vanart;

    Sammanfattning : År 1876 inrättades uppfostringsanstalten Hall utanför Södertälje. Anstalten var en av de första anstalterna i Sverige som tog emot pojkar i åldrarna 10-15 år som hade dömts i domstol till att insättas på uppfostringsanstalt.   2. 17. Psychobiological functioning in mid-adolescent girls and boys : Linkages to self reported stress, self-esteem and recurrent pain

    Författare :Lisa Folkesson Hellstadius; Petra Lindfors; Laura Ferrer-Wreder; Roger Persson; Stockholms universitet; []
    Nyckelord :SAMHÄLLSVETENSKAP; SOCIAL SCIENCES; Adolescents; Cortisol; Alpha-amylase; Stress; Self-esteem; Recurrent pain; Psychology; psykologi;

    Sammanfattning : Among adolescents, the day-to-day functioning of the hypothalamo-pituitary-adrenal-axis (HPA-axis) and of the autonomic nervous system (ANS) and their relationships with stress, subjective health complaints and psychological factors such as self-esteem, studied in naturalistic settings, have been largely unexplored. This thesis aimed to investigate the diurnal activity of the HPA-axis (Studies I & II) in terms of salivary cortisol and the ANS/SNS system (Study III) in terms of salivary alpha-amylase (sAA) in mid-adolescent girls and boys.
